日韩黑丝制服一区视频播放|日韩欧美人妻丝袜视频在线观看|九九影院一级蜜桃|亚洲中文在线导航|青草草视频在线观看|婷婷五月色伊人网站|日本一区二区在线|国产AV一二三四区毛片|正在播放久草视频|亚洲色图精品一区

分享

使用Try.NET創(chuàng)建可交互.NET文檔

 蘭亭文藝 2019-06-21

譯者:Lamond Lu

譯文:https://www.cnblogs.com/lwqlun/p/10894497.html

原文作者:Maria

原文鏈接:https://devblogs.microsoft.com/dotnet/creating-interactive-net-documentation/

背景

當(dāng)我們編寫開發(fā)人員使用的文檔時(shí),我們需要捕捉他們的興趣,并引導(dǎo)他們盡快走上成功的道路。開發(fā)人員生態(tài)系統(tǒng)一直在為社區(qū)提供可交互的文檔,用戶可以一個(gè)地方閱讀文檔,運(yùn)行代碼并進(jìn)行編輯。

在過去的2年里,.NET語言團(tuán)隊(duì)一直在不斷發(fā)展Try .NET, 以支持在線和離線的交互式文檔。

什么是Try .NET

Try .NET是一個(gè)基于.NET Core的交互式文檔生成器。

控制臺(tái)標(biāo)簽頁: *WASM Initialized*

網(wǎng)絡(luò)標(biāo)簽頁: DLLs

Try .NET提供了全局工具dotnet try, 以方便.NET開發(fā)人員創(chuàng)建可交互的Markdown文件。

為了使你的Markdown文件具有交互性,你需要安裝.NET Core的SDK, 全局工具dotnet try, 以及Visual Studio / VS Code。

``` cs
var name ='Rain';
Console.WriteLine($'Hello {name.ToUpper()}!');
```

使用Try .NET, 我們可以擴(kuò)展隔離代碼塊,給它添加一些額外的參數(shù)。

``` cs --region methods --source-file .myappProgram.cs --project .myappmyapp.csproj 
var name ='Rain';
Console.WriteLine($'Hello {name.ToUpper()}!');
```

使用

在Markdown中,我們擴(kuò)展了代碼塊,提供了--region參數(shù),用它可以指定C代碼中的分塊(region)。

所以,你的Program.cs文件看起來可能是這樣的。

using System;
namespace HelloWorld
{
class Program
{
static void Main(string[] args)
{
region methods
var name ='Rain'
Console.WriteLine($'Hello{name.ToUpper()}!');
endregion
}
}
}

嘗試使用全局工具dotnet try

dotnet try現(xiàn)在已經(jīng)可以使用了。這是一個(gè)dotnet try全局工具的早期預(yù)覽版,你可以從我們的倉儲(chǔ)克隆代碼。

入門

  • 克隆代碼倉儲(chǔ)

  • 簽出Samples分支

  • 安裝.NET Core 2.1或3.0預(yù)覽版

  • 打開控制臺(tái)窗口

  • 安裝Try .NET全局工具

dotnet tool install --global dotnet-try --version 1.0.19264.11

更新dotnet try也很簡單,只需要運(yùn)行如下命令

dotnet tool update -g dotnet-try

定位到當(dāng)前倉儲(chǔ)的Samples目錄,輸入dotnet try

瀏覽器會(huì)自動(dòng)打開


編號(hào)317,輸入編號(hào)直達(dá)本文

●輸入m獲取文章目錄

    本站是提供個(gè)人知識(shí)管理的網(wǎng)絡(luò)存儲(chǔ)空間,所有內(nèi)容均由用戶發(fā)布,不代表本站觀點(diǎn)。請(qǐng)注意甄別內(nèi)容中的聯(lián)系方式、誘導(dǎo)購買等信息,謹(jǐn)防詐騙。如發(fā)現(xiàn)有害或侵權(quán)內(nèi)容,請(qǐng)點(diǎn)擊一鍵舉報(bào)。
    轉(zhuǎn)藏 分享 獻(xiàn)花(0

    0條評(píng)論

    發(fā)表

    請(qǐng)遵守用戶 評(píng)論公約

    類似文章 更多